1. 10 Ounce Chenille

5 Best Fabrics for Burp Cloths (1)

Cotton chenille is a great choice for burp cloths. It’s thick and durable, but also soft to the touch. One of the best properties of cotton chenille is that it absorbs water. Try combining cotton chenille with terrycloth on the opposite side for even more absorbency.

  • Easily laundered with cold water and can be dried in the dryer regular on low heat setting
  • Chenille lasts for a surprisingly long time- can be used over and over again and still retain its softness
  • This fabric is 100% cotton, which is hypoallergenic

2. Terrycloth Fabric

5 Best Fabrics for Burp Cloths (2)

Use terrycloth on its own or combine it with another fabric, one side terrycloth, the other a fabric like cotton chenille. Terrycloth on its own has excellent absorbent properties. It soaks up fast and can hold a lot of moisture.

  • This terrycloth is made from 100% cotton, which is naturally hypoallergenic
  • Can be laundered easily and is durable to hold up to multiple uses and washes
  • Soft and versatile

3. Oasis Fun Flannels

5 Best Fabrics for Burp Cloths (3)

One of the best parts about sewing for babies is all the many fun and cute fabric patterns and colors you can pick from. The Oasis Fun Flannels line is filled with adorable patterns and colors for the perfect burp cloths. The flannel is 100% cotton.

  • Durable, but soft to the touch
  • Absorbent
  • Flannel often gets softer after every wash which makes it a great choice for burp cloths

5. Cuddle 3 Minky

5 Best Fabrics for Burp Cloths (5)

Minky is a great fabric to use for burp cloths if something a little fancier is desired. Minky is a popular fabric to use when sewing baby items and extras can be used on other projects like baby blankets. For burp cloths, it is likely best to combine minky with a soft, absorbent fabric like a cotton flannel.

  • Very soft to the touch
  • Comes in a wide variety of colors
  • Can be machine washed and dried in the dryer on low heat

Versatile Fabrics

Burp cloths can be made from many different fabrics. Flannels, minky, terrycloth, cotton, and chenille are all popular fabrics and they can, for the most part, be combined with one another to make extra absorbent or extra cute combinations. Try using a solid fabric on the back like minky or terrycloth and adding a fun flannel print on the other side. The combinations you can make are pretty much endless.

What is most absorbent fabric? ›

Cotton and Rayon(Viscose) absorb and retains maximum water. Cotton is a natural fiber whereas Rayon is a regenerated cellulosic fiber. Both are hydrophilic in nature and negatively charged fibers attract dipolar water molecules.

What is the best size for a burp cloth? ›

What is the standard size of a baby burp cloth? Most burp cloths are around 15 -22” in length and 10 - 15” in width. They are this long so that they offer as much coverage as possible and also drape over the shoulder without falling off.
